I don't know if there's a better way, but if you're on Windows this should work: Press and hold the Windows key and press R. Paste the following line into the Run box that appears, then press Enter or click OK: %appdata%\Affinity\Publisher\1.0\Samples That will open a File Explorer window for that directory, and you can delete the file from there. I don't know where they'd be located on a Mac.
